Push Pin Europe Map - Bonus 50pins - Personalized Gifts - Travel …
Rating: 761 reviews from 1 sources
Reviews
Selected Review of 761 Reviews
I received the maps quickly, and am very happy with the quality! The paper is sturdy and like a thick poster. The print quality and resolution is also … Read full review
www.etsy.com